Smile Solaris 10 for free ($0)


Solaris new pricing model for Solaris 10 is available at:
http://wwws.sun.com/software/solaris...smodelfaq.html
A free license for up to 4 CPU on SPARC / x86 H/W will be available, and not restricted to non commercial use, like previous were !

First, My posting was referring to Solaris 10 which is not yet available (it should be by the end of next january).

Second, you can download a beta version, which still has the previous licensing restriction, at:
http://wwws.sun.com/software/solaris...press/get.html

About half a million Solaris downloads have been made in the last 12 month or so, and I'm not aware of any problem on the site.
